Please tell me you're only doing this for 2 weeks! I don't think it's sustainable for you to workout twice a day. Also...in that little crazy diet of yours...I would add a protein shake...your body will enjoy a that after all that running (a glass of low fat chocolate milk or carb-controlled protein shake, EAS or Muscle Milk Light are good ones that are available at grocery stores).

Try to calculate something like this for about 1300 calories per day. With all the exercise you're doing this should be doable to burn more than what you consume and therefore lose weight. ***I am not a nutrition expert, just a fan*** these are just some examples...hope you can win!


early AM - coffee - 200 cals
late AM - breakfast - 250 cals (1 breakfast taco - egg whites & ground turkey, low fat shredded cheese)
Lunch/early PM - maintain at 300 cals (make this your carb heavy meal - small bowl of pasta w chicken, rice w chicken...stick to small 300 cals)
Late PM - snack - 200 cals (EAS bar or shake)
Night (before 9PM or 2 hours before bed) - 350 cals (no carbs - vegetables, protein)
